CVE-2007-5900

18
FAUCET Score

CVE-2007-5900 describes a vulnerability in PHP before version 5.2.5 that allows local users to bypass administrative configuration settings (php_admin_value or php_admin_flag) by using the ini_set function to modify arbitrary configuration variables. This vulnerability carries a CVSS score of 6.9, indicating high severity due to its local attack vector, medium attack complexity, and complete compromise of confidentiality, integrity, and availability. There is no evidence of active exploitation, publicly available exploit code (Metasploit, Nuclei, ExploitDB), or significant community discussion or media coverage surrounding this CVE.
